A bachelor's degree in visual and performing arts is more popular than many other degrees. In fact, it ranks #8 out of 38 on popularity of all such degrees in the nation. This means you won't have too much trouble finding schools that offer the degree.

In 2022, College Factual analyzed 11 schools in order to identify the top ones for its Most Popular Bachelor's Degree Colleges for Visual & Performing Arts in Utah ranking. Combined, these schools handed out 1,325 bachelor's degrees in visual and performing arts to qualified students.

You'll be surrounded by many like-minded peers at Brigham Young University - Provo if you want to pursue a bachelor's degree in visual and performing arts. BYU is a fairly large private not-for-profit university located in the medium-sized city of Provo. This isn't the only ranking where the school placed. It's also #1 in quality for bachelor's degrees in visual and performing arts in Utah.

There were about 353 visual and performing arts individuals who graduated with this degree at BYU in the most recent data year.
